Creating a multi-channel social media strategy
It is important to take into consideration the unique characteristics of each channel when creating multi-channel content strategies on social media. Image-based channels may do better than others. LinkedIn, on the other hand, may benefit from more editorial content. It is important to adapt your messaging for different channels when creating content. Additionally, you should be capable of assessing how your content performs across different channels to adjust your strategy.
Blogs can be easily adapted to social channels and used for email marketing. You can identify which channels will work best by analyzing the performance of each channel. From there, you can consider expanding your strategy into other channels. Start small and expand on that. You can create a multi-channel social media content strategy by trying out different platforms and determining what works best for your brand.

How can I measure success with content marketing?
There are several ways to measure the effectiveness of your content marketing strategy.
Google Analytics is a good tool to measure your progress. This tool lets you see where your targeted traffic comes from and what pages they visit most frequently.
It will also show you how long each visitor stays before leaving your site.
This information can be used to improve your content and to keep people engaged for longer periods.
The following questions will help you to measure the success and failure of your content marketing efforts:
Is my email newsletter providing any value to my subscribers? What percentage of my entire mailing list has converted into paying memberships? How many people have clicked through my landing page? Are click-throughs more successful than other types of conversions?
These are all important metrics that you should track and monitor over time.
Another great way to measure success in content marketing is to track the number of people sharing your content on social media.
